How to check if two integers have opposite signs in C

#include <stdio.h>
#include <stdbool.h>

int main() {
    int x = 3, y = -9;            

    bool b = ((x ^ y) < 0); 
    printf("%d\n", b);
    
    x = 5, y = 6;
    
    b = ((x ^ y) < 0); 
    printf("%d\n", b);
}


/*
run:

1
0

*/
